Output 216ad59f301e5264a41b8a4315d51ef1ef03d45a7e5583bcfe3cbc10dcda170e:0

value
28431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93b415162db22b93d45407e35819246304236813 OP_EQUAL
address
3F9zz5txHTcPSZsh89CtLTF8LnnusU2Pe6
transaction
216ad59f301e5264a41b8a4315d51ef1ef03d45a7e5583bcfe3cbc10dcda170e
confirmations
312013
spent
true